Carol Jones

2025 Incumbent Candidate for

First Selectman in Deep River, CT.  

Carol has lived in Deep River for over 30 years. Throughout that time, she has been an active volunteer, and has served on various Boards and Commissions, as a Girl Scout leader, a volunteer with the Boy Scouts, an assistant in a wide range of school activities, and as a Sunday school teacher.  

Carol has been employed by the town of Deep River for nearly 15 years. Before being elected First Selectman, she served as its first full-time Parks and Recreation Director.  She continues to volunteer as a member of the United Way, the Women's United group, and as a Sunday school teacher. She has dedicated her life here to making it a better place for all. Her weekly newsletters (online at the town’s website and via email) have been very well-received, and residents have told her that they appreciate the delineation of her efforts and her transparency and honesty.

Carol Jones believes strongly in Deep River. She is seeking re-election because she wants to continue to move major issues forward. She believes in high-quality public education and supports school restructuring, for both the cost savings to residents and for the educational benefits for our children. She has been actively working to market Deep River to recruit new businesses in order to increase our tax base and lower taxes, and wants to liven up our public spaces with renovated facilities and public art. Carol enjoys listening to her constituents and will continue to work tirelessly for the betterment of the town and all of its residents.
